19th Century Amboyna Occasional Table
Located in Bedfordshire, GB
A delightful 19th century occasional lamp, or wine table, with well figured amboyna circular top and ormolu moulding raised on three elegant ebonized and inlaid turned supports, terminating with triform plateau and elegant sabre feet.
Although victorian in date this table draws on a variety of different stylistic features, from a range of different periods. The use of beautiful amboyna veneers, set against ebonised mouldings is very much a 19th century feature however, the contrast created providing both a boldness and elegance all in one.
This little occasional table is constructed from excellent timbers and when taking into account the overall quality of construction as well it is clear that it was produced in one of the top cabinet makers workshops of the time.
Surprisingly sturdy for such a small article, which is due to the intelligent triple support design, this is a most practical table indeed, perfect for a wide variety of spots around the home, where one can use it to house a lamp, some photo frames or even a nice glass of wine.
